The Role of Painkiller Pharmacies
Painkiller pharmacies serve a pivotal function in managing both acute and chronic pain conditions. Their duties include:
Dispensing medications according to prescriptions.Using recommendations and consultations for pain management.Educating clients on the appropriate usage of painkillers, including possible adverse effects and dependency risks.Tracking clients for indications of abuse or dependence.Table 1: Types of Painkillers AvailableKind of PainkillerTypical MedicationsDescriptionUse CasesNon-opioid AnalgesicsAcetaminophen, IbuprofenOver-the-counter medications for mild-to-moderate pain relief.Headaches, small injuries, Schmerzmittel arthritis.OpioidsOxycodone, Morphine, FentanylPrescription medications for serious pain.Cancer pain, post-surgical pain, extreme injuries.Adjuvant AnalgesicsGabapentin, AntidepressantsMedications that help in pain relief, typically used for nerve pain.Neuropathic pain, fibromyalgia, migraines.Topical AnalgesicsLidocaine patches, Capsaicin creamLocalized pain relief used straight to the skin.Arthritis, muscle pain, localized nerve pain.The Pros and Cons of Painkillers
When considering pain management options, it is vital to weigh the benefits against the possible disadvantages of painkillers.
Pros:Immediate Relief: Painkillers can provide fast-acting relief, substantially improving quality of life for those experiencing pain.Range of Options: A wide variety of pain medications accommodates various kinds of pain and client requirements, from moderate to severe.Improved Functionality: Effective pain management allows people to resume everyday activities, work, and enjoy life.Adjustable Dosing: Dosages can typically be customized to specific needs based on the severity of pain and client reaction.Cons:Side Effects: Common side results include queasiness, lightheadedness, irregularity, and sleepiness, which can hinder everyday activities.Addiction Risk: Opioids, in specific, have a high potential for reliance and dependency, which can result in severe health crises.Tolerance Development: Over time, clients may require higher dosages to attain the exact same level of pain relief, resulting in increased risk of side impacts.Withdrawal Symptoms: Stopping painkillers suddenly, especially opioids, can lead to withdrawal symptoms, making complex the cessation process.Table 2: Common Side Effects of PainkillersType of PainkillerTypical Side EffectsLikelihoodNon-opioid AnalgesicsStomach upset, liver damage (due to overdose)Low to ModerateOpioidsSleepiness, irregularity, respiratory depressionHighAdjuvant AnalgesicsDizziness, weight gain, dry mouthModerateTopical AnalgesicsSkin inflammation, allergic responsesLowBest Practices: Responsible Usage of Painkillers
To ensure security and effectiveness in pain management, patients and healthcare providers must embrace best practices:

Consult Healthcare Professionals: Before beginning any pain medication, people should seek advice from their doctor. This consists of discussing their medical history, any existing medications, and particular pain management requirements.

Follow Prescriptions Carefully: Adhering to recommended dosages and schedules is crucial in preventing complications and making sure efficient pain management.

Educate on Risks: Patients must be informed about the potential risks of dependency, specifically with opioids, and be recommended on recognizing early signs of abuse.

Think About Alternative Therapies: Many clients benefit from a holistic method to pain management, consisting of physical therapy, chiropractic care, acupuncture, and mindfulness techniques.

Regular Monitoring: Patients using painkillers, especially opioids, must be kept an eye on regularly by their doctor for indications of dependence or adverse effects.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. What should I do if I experience side impacts from painkillers?
You ought to right away contact your healthcare company to discuss the negative effects experienced. They may change your dose or recommend an alternative medication.
2. Can I take painkillers if I have other medical conditions?
Always seek advice from with your health care supplier before starting a brand-new medication, especially if you have chronic conditions such as liver disease, kidney disease, or a history of substance abuse.
3. What are the signs of opioid addiction?
Signs of opioid addiction consist of a strong yearning for the medication, using it for factors besides recommended, and experiencing withdrawal symptoms when not using the drug.
4. Exist non-medication options for pain management?
Yes, lots of non-medication choices exist, including physical treatment, acupuncture, cognitive-behavioral treatment, and way of life changes like workout and diet adjustments.
5. How can drug stores assist in preventing prescription drug abuse?
Drug stores can assist by providing education about medications, monitoring prescriptions for prospective abuse, and implementing programs for safe disposal of unused medications.
